My wife has a Mark IV 22/45 lite and a Ruger 10/22 take down. Both of them love the federal black label stuff.
The take down had the overspray on the inner receiver scrubbed down with a scotch bright pad, top of the bolt polishes and the rear of the bolt radiusd slightly just with sand paper to aid in cycling. This was done very early in the life of the firearm so can't really comment on "before". I know after words there is no problems running the federal stuff.
Perhaps there is something interfering with the bolt cycling that is the root cause of the issues.
